Preparing the cleaning solution:
In a bucket, mix hot water, vinegar, baking soda and dishwashing liquid. If you want the mop to have a pleasant smell, add a few drops of essential oil.
Soaking the mop:
Immerse the mop in the prepared solution and leave for about 30-60 minutes to dissolve dried dirt and grease.
Cleaning:
After soaking, rinse the mop thoroughly under running water, making sure to remove all dirt and detergent residue.
Machine wash (optional):
If the mop is machine washable, wash it on a gentle cycle using a small amount of detergent. Avoid bleach, which can damage the fibers.
Drying:
Leave the mop to dry in a well-ventilated area, preferably in the sun, to avoid the growth of bacteria and mold.
Serving and storage tips
Rinse the mop under running water after each use to avoid dirt build-up.
Store the mop in a dry place, preferably in an upright position, to make it easier to dry.
Replace the mop head regularly if you notice that the fibers are too worn or damaged.
